Laravel  
laravel
文档
数据库
架构
入门
php技术
    
Laravelphp
laravel / php / java / vue / mysql / linux / python / javascript / html / css / c++ / c#

round函数的用法python

作者:倾尽尘光暖流年   发布日期:2025-06-19   浏览:50

# 示例代码:使用 round 函数对数字进行四舍五入

# 对一个浮点数进行四舍五入到最接近的整数
num1 = 3.7
rounded_num1 = round(num1)
print(f"原始数字: {num1}, 四舍五入后: {rounded_num1}")  # 输出: 原始数字: 3.7, 四舍五入后: 4

# 对一个浮点数进行四舍五入并指定小数位数
num2 = 3.14159
rounded_num2 = round(num2, 2)
print(f"原始数字: {num2}, 四舍五入后: {rounded_num2}")  # 输出: 原始数字: 3.14159, 四舍五入后: 3.14

# 对一个负数进行四舍五入
num3 = -2.5
rounded_num3 = round(num3)
print(f"原始数字: {num3}, 四舍五入后: {rounded_num3}")  # 输出: 原始数字: -2.5, 四舍五入后: -2

# 当数值正好在两个整数中间时,round 函数会四舍五入到最近的偶数(银行家舍入法)
num4 = 2.5
rounded_num4 = round(num4)
print(f"原始数字: {num4}, 四舍五入后: {rounded_num4}")  # 输出: 原始数字: 2.5, 四舍五入后: 2

num5 = 3.5
rounded_num5 = round(num5)
print(f"原始数字: {num5}, 四舍五入后: {rounded_num5}")  # 输出: 原始数字: 3.5, 四舍五入后: 4

解释说明:

  • round(number, ndigits) 是 Python 内置的函数,用于对数字进行四舍五入。
  • number 是要四舍五入的数字。
  • ndigits 是可选参数,表示保留的小数位数。如果不提供此参数,则默认四舍五入到最接近的整数。
  • 当数值正好在两个整数中间时(如 2.5 或 3.5),round 函数会采用“银行家舍入法”,即四舍五入到最近的偶数。

上一篇:python sqrt

下一篇:python数字转化为字符串

大家都在看

python时间格式

python ord和chr

python中的yield

python自定义异常

python list.pop

python的for i in range

npm config set python

python代码简单

python读取文件夹

python中turtle

Laravel PHP 深圳智简公司。版权所有©2023-2043 LaravelPHP 粤ICP备2021048745号-3

Laravel 中文站